What type of life insurance should I get?

There are two main types of life insurance: term life and whole life:

  • Term life – Term policies are in place for a set period of time (generally up to 30 years) and come at a fixed rate. If death occurs during the term, the beneficiary will receive payment. If not, the terms of the policy—including the monthly payments—must be renegotiated.
  • Whole life/Universal – While a term life policy only exists for a set amount of time, a whole life or universal policy is permanent, and guarantees fixed premiums for a lifetime. It may also carry a guaranteed cash value, depending on your plan.

What factors can affect my life insurance premium?

The cost of life insurance depends on several factors, including:

  • Age – rates tend to increase as you get older
  • Gender – women tend to live longer and their rates tend to be lower
  • Occupation – high-risk occupations could increase premiums
  • Health/Medical history – a healthy, nonsmoker could potentially pay a lower rate
